Transaction

af5bb2c3fead0ec3e0dfb151e80be9a6f76c0b4e81b71a1958a0cd2cc7dec242
499,258 confirmations
Timestamp
1476067860
Block433,705
Fee184,390 sats
Fee rate51.5 sats/vB
view on mempool.space

Inputs & Outputs

Outputs